Presenter and Moderator Bios
Fred O. Lindsley, CPA has twenty-five years experience as a CPA. He started his public accounting career at Coopers & Lybrand and then became a founding partner of two Florida based CPA firms.

As a small business owner and CPA, Fred recognized a growing need for greater efficiencies in back office tools including monthly reconciliation, comprehensive time and billing reporting and staff performance measurement reporting. To satisfy these needs, he started a software technology firm, ImagineTime Inc. Fred has invested over fifteen years researching and developing ImagineTime’s software technology. His extensive small business and CPA experience provides the foundation from which ImagineTime’s efficient and robust technology was developed.

Mr. Lindsley is a well-respected industry expert, who frequently presents on integration of back office technology into CPA firms. He has taught accounting courses at Florida Atlantic University, and served on the Florida Institute of Certified Public Accountants (FICPA) “Committee on Microcomputers”. He is a published author and writes articles on CPA practice management.
